Myth No. 5: “You need to get a trim every six weeks”

“A beautiful haircut should last a minimum of three months. Period. If you are fussing with your hair just a few weeks after your cut, something is off,” says celebrity hairstylist Joshua-Myles Ristaino. To nip this problem in the bud, Ristaino suggests talking with your stylist in depth about what you want, how you take care of your hair, and any issues you’ve had with past cuts. Stylists want to keep their clients, so they should be willing to work with you so you can get a cut that lasts longer than six weeks, he says.
